From: Parkinson’s disease-linked Parkin mutations impair glutamatergic signaling in hippocampal neurons

Fig. 5

Parkin-mediated GluN1 ubiquitination is impaired in pathogenic mutants. a Representative immunoblots for GFP immunoprecipitation (IP) from HEK293T cell lysates expressing Myc/Myc-Parkin, GFP-GluA1/-GluA2/-GluN1/-GluN2B, and HA-ubiquitin, probed for HA and GFP. Ubiquitin immunoreactivity used for quantification is marked on HA blots. b Quantification of GFP-GluA or GluN ubiquitination, expressed as the ratio of marked HA blot intensity (a) with Myc-Parkin (+) to Myc control (−), then normalized to immunoprecipitated GFP, GFP-GluA or GluN (n = 3 experiments, *P < 0.05; one-way ANOVA, error bars represent SEM). c Representative Myc and GFP immunoblots for Myc IP from HEK293T cell lysates expressing Myc-Parkin and GFP-GluA1/-GluA2/-GluN1/-GluN2B. Arrowhead indicates immunoprecipitated Myc-Parkin (just below IgG band). d Representative HA and Flag immunoblots for Flag IP from HEK293T cell lysates expressing Flag-GluN1, GFP control/GFP-Parkin WT/C431S/W403A, and HA-ubiquitin. Arrowhead indicates immunoprecipitated Flag-GluN1. Ubiquitin immunoreactivity used for quantification is marked on HA blots. e Quantification of Flag-GluN1 ubiquitination by measurement of marked HA blot intensity (d), normalized to immunoprecipitated Flag-GluN1 and reported as a fraction of GFP control (n = 3 experiments, **P < 0.01, ***P < 0.001, one-way ANOVA, error bars represent SEM). f Representative HA and Flag immunoblots for Flag IP from HEK293T cell lysates expressing Flag-GluN1, GFP control/GFP-Parkin WT/T240M/R275W/R334C/G430D constructs, and HA-ubiquitin. Arrowhead indicates immunoprecipitated Flag-GluN1. Ubiquitin immunoreactivity used for quantification is marked on HA blots. g Quantification of Flag-GluN1 ubiquitination by measurement of marked HA intensity (f), normalized to immunoprecipitated Flag-GluN1 and reported as a fraction of GFP condition (n = 3 experiments, *P < 0.05; **P < 0.01, ***P < 0.001, one-way ANOVA, error bars represent SEM)
